Taxonomic Classification

Rank African civet Bell'S Honeysuckle
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Carnivora (Carnivorans) Dipsacales (Dipsacales)
Family Viverridae Caprifoliaceae
Genus Civettictis Lonicera
Species Civettictis civetta Lonicera bella
